2.6 Subcontractor Management and Personnel <br /> Subcontractor management is responsible for the compliance of their personnel with this <br /> Project HASP Since subcontractors are hired for their speck expertise, they must assume <br /> primary responsibility for the health and safety of their personnel The subcontractor's Field <br /> Supervisor, or Crew Leader will also be responsible for performing a weekly safety inspection <br /> of their operations A copy of this inspection must be submitted to the Protect FC each week <br /> ' - <br /> Subcontractor personnel must abide by the requirements of this HASP, and must follow the <br /> ' instructions of their company management and rr Protect Representatives in all health and <br /> safety related matters <br /> ' 2.7 On-Site Personnel and Visitors <br /> No visitor will be allowed within the Work Zones without authon.zatnon from the PM and the <br /> Project FC Visitors requesting authorization to enter the Contamination Reduction Zones <br /> (CRZs) or Exclusion Zones (EZs) must meet the requirements established for Project <br />' Personnel, mcludmg appropriate medical exams and training On-site client personnel will <br /> also be held to these requirements. <br /> 1 <br />' MZ/11-29-94/RHS/HASPj94-0037 JAF 2_6 <br />
